Delighted that Last Man Standing is back on TV. Loved the jabs they took at ABC in the first episode, and it was funny as usual.
The second episode was not as funny as usual. Of course, they were dealing with the death of a loved one. Vanessa was right, Mike needed to grieve, although, for some that's hard to do. I could really identify with Mike. When my dad died, I didn't grieve. My dad was not the best dad. He certainly had his good points, but when we think of people, we often think about the negative things. For some reason, negative things that people do seem to have a greater impact on us than the positive things they do. At first that's what Mike thought about. But, then he was out in the garage alone, where he talked to his dad who was sitting on his favorite chair. I thought that was very good. The writers and the actors came together and dealt with the issue with dignity and class. This episode was one of the best.
There was humor in the show too. Kyle figuring out what to wear on his new job at Outdoor Man, and Mandy helping him. As usual Kyle was funny. And I do love his new hairdo.
